A record was broken Sunday at the Norwood Village Green Concert Series when $2,755 was collected in the series traditional pass the bucket during a performance by the Gibson Brothers.
Joseph M. Liotta, president and founding program director of the series, said the previous record of $1,725 was established in 1987 when the Canadian country group Family Brown performed.
Anticipating a large audience turnout, a third bucket was purchased for the event and three zones were created, Mr. Liotta said.
He added that while the Gibson Brothers concert did break the pass the bucket record, it did not break the series attendance record. That honor still belongs to Family Brown with more than 4,500 people in attendance, he said. About 3,000 attended Sundays concert.
